What Counts as a Landscaping Emergency?
Not every landscaping problem needs an immediate call. But some situations are urgent and require a fast response. Here are clear examples:
- A large tree or big limb has fallen and is blocking your driveway, leaning on your house, or is on a power line.
- Severe erosion is washing soil away from your home's foundation or your driveway, threatening its stability.
- Heavy, standing water is flooding your yard and is close to seeping into your basement or threatening a septic system.
- You can see exposed utility lines or pipes after a storm or excavation work. (For this, call your utility company immediately first).
- A large tree is visibly leaning or has a deep crack in the trunk after high winds.
In any emergency, safety comes first. Keep people and pets away from the danger zone.
Zelienople's Climate, Soil, and Your Landscape
Our local conditions in Butler County really shape your landscaping needs. Zelienople experiences all four seasons: humid summers, crisp falls, cold winters with freeze-thaw cycles, and wet springs. This means plants need to be hardy.
Many yards in Zelienople have clay-heavy soil, which holds water. After one of our classic spring storms, this can lead to pooling in low spots. In older neighborhoods, like those near Zelienople Community Park, mature trees like oaks and maples are beautiful but can be vulnerable to heavy ice loads.
Homes vary from historic properties with large, established lots to newer developments with smaller yards. Each type has different needs, whether it's managing mature tree roots or designing a low-maintenance space. If you live in a community with an HOA, their rules will also affect your landscaping choices.

Understanding Costs for Landscaping in Zelienople
Landscaping costs depend on many factors. To provide accurate local figures, we researched average costs in the Zelienople, PA area. Here are general findings based on regional data:
- Emergency Call-Out/After-Hours Fee: Many companies charge a premium for urgent, after-hours response, often ranging from $100 to $300 on top of project costs.
- Hourly Labor Rates: For non-emergency work, landscaping labor in Pennsylvania typically ranges from $50 to $100 per hour per worker, depending on the skill required.
- Common Project Costs (Estimates):
- Emergency removal of a small fallen tree (crew + chipper): $200 – $800.
- Large tree removal requiring a crane or permit: $1,200 – $5,000+.
- Drainage correction (like a French drain): $1,000 – $4,000 depending on length and depth.
- New sod installation for an average yard: $1,000 – $3,000 (materials + labor).
- Irrigation repair: Service call/diagnostic: $75 – $150; repairs: $100 – $800+.
Sources: Regional cost guides from HomeAdvisor, Angi, and industry pricing surveys for Western Pennsylvania. These are estimates; actual quotes will vary.
Emergency visits cost more due to overtime pay, rapid mobilization of crews and equipment, and the inherent risks of the job.

Safety Checklist Before Help Arrives
If you have a landscaping emergency, follow these steps while you wait for professionals:
- Keep all people and pets away from the hazard zone.
- If you see downed power lines, stay far back and call your utility company immediately. Do not touch anything.
- Take photos of the damage for your insurance company.
- Move vehicles away from fallen trees or areas that are flooding.
- If an irrigation leak is causing flooding, locate and shut off the main water valve to the system.
- Secure any loose patio furniture or objects that could blow away in continuing wind.
Important Warning: Do not try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. This is dangerous work for professionals. Always call 811 before you or any contractor plans to dig.

Choosing a Landscaping Contractor in Zelienople
When you need help, choose a local pro you can trust. Look for:
- Proper licensing and insurance for your protection.
- Local references and photos of past work in the area.
- Verified reviews from other Zelienople homeowners.
- Transparent, written estimates with itemized costs.
- A clear plan for cleanup and disposal of debris.
For tree work, ask if they have an ISA-certified arborist on staff. Good questions to ask are: "What's your estimated timeline?" "Can you provide proof of insurance?" and "How do you handle permits if needed?"
